Key Responsibilities

In this role, you will be responsible for the safe and efficient execution of complex technical work on offshore wind turbines. Your core duties will include:

  • Executing mechanical, electrical, and hydraulic maintenance, repairs, and troubleshooting on Vestas offshore wind turbines.
  • Rigorously applying the Wind Turbine Safety Rules (WTSR) as a formal Safe System of Work to manage high-risk energy sources and protect personnel.
  • Safely operating and inspecting Avanti service lifts and other access equipment within the turbine, following strict manufacturer protocols.
  • Participating in turbine installation, commissioning activities, and major component exchanges.
  • Conducting advanced rescue operations and providing enhanced first aid in a remote offshore environment.
  • Accurately documenting all work activities, safety checks, and parts usage in compliance with company and client reporting systems.

Qualifications 

To be successful, you must possess a strong technical background and hold the following current, valid certifications:

  • This is a non-negotiable requirement. You must hold a full suite of GWO Basic Safety Training, plus:
  • Certification in advanced lifesaving measures for remote environments.
  •  Valid certification in Vestas MMI and Practical Training, Technical Training, and Operational Safety modules.
  • Certification as a competent technician under the WTSR framework, which is critical for implementing a Safe System of Work.
  • Formal operator training for Avanti service lifts (e.g., Dolphin, LXL models) or equivalent “Lift User” certification.
  •  A valid OGUK or RUK Medical Certificate, which includes successfully passing the Chester Step Test to demonstrate aerobic fitness for offshore work.
